FERAL CATS

Predation by feral cats is listed as a key threatening process under section 188 of Australia’s national environment law, the Environment Protection and Biodiversity Conservation Act 1999 (EPBC Act).

FOXES

Foxes (Vulpes vulpes) are opportunistic predators and scavengers and have few natural predators in Australia.
